For example for a #8 flat head screw in .042 thick material, we would punch a .250 diameter hole and countersink to .320 (.335 plus .305 divided by 2) plus or minus .015. Form countersinking, also known as dimpling, is a countersink that is formed into sheet metal to increase the strength of a structure as the countersinks of multiple pieces nest together. A rule of thumb for determining a pre-punch hole size is: Pre-Punch Hole Size = B [(B C) x .75], where B is the largest opening at the top of the countersink and C the desired opening at the bottom. The reason that location is often tied to the C dimension is that physically checking the hole location is easer on the C dimension than trying to find the theoretical center of the countersink angle.
